La Noguera Pallaresa (Catalonia)

We´re back in the high Catalonian Pyrenees and set up our camp at the river Noguera PallaresanearLlavorsí. This is our home base for excursions to the following destinations:

TheAlt Pirineu Natural Park

The civil war memorial sites Pedres d´Aulóandla Crestelleta

Locations of Jaume Cabré´s novel Les veus del Pamano (Die Stimmen des Flusses, German)

When I went to Barcelona, it was important to me to read books in Catalan. It involved a fair amount of research, because there aren’t nearly as many books available in English translation from Catalan as I would like. So now, I’ve brought all those favorites—including novels by Carmen Laforet, Jordi Puntí, and Mercè Rodoreda—into one fantastic list for Book Riot. Dive into literature written in Catalan, a language that was once banned throughout Spain but has experienced a tremendous resurgence—the language of Barcelona.
